Output 2881ed115d95f6278b66c9e4007d2e5db92149eb7a000e145ff8aeaa6d887854:3

value
673936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 052d36ff75247b2f8c3998743e45dc5bb6d64aa6 OP_EQUAL
address
32APU5sMSkr6FjiZfBpRB7YuDxCMsQfgi8
transaction
2881ed115d95f6278b66c9e4007d2e5db92149eb7a000e145ff8aeaa6d887854